How To Choose Personalized Christmas Gifts For Coworkers

Choosing a personalized gift requires careful consideration, creativity, and observation. The first step is to think beyond generic gift options-like mugs, calendars, or gift cards-and instead focus on items that reflect the recipient’s unique personality or interests. Personalization can be as simple as adding a name or initials to an item, or as elaborate as selecting a gift that aligns with a specific hobby, passion, or shared memory.

Consider the nature of your workplace and the level of closeness you share with the recipient. For colleagues with whom you have frequent interactions and rapport, gifts that reflect shared jokes, inside references, or mutual experiences can be particularly meaningful. Conversely, for more distant coworkers, subtle personalization-like engraved pens, monogrammed notebooks, or customized office décor-can strike the perfect balance between thoughtful and professional.

The key is to make your gift feel intentional rather than obligatory. It should communicate that you have taken time to consider what the recipient would genuinely enjoy, rather than defaulting to a generic ’safe’ option. Personalization conveys attention to detail, effort, and respect, which can deepen workplace relationships and strengthen professional bonds.

Understanding The Needs Of Your Recipient

A truly thoughtful gift begins with understanding the recipient’s needs, preferences, and lifestyle. Observation is critical: what do they keep on their desk? Do they talk about hobbies, favorite foods, or personal goals? Have they mentioned things they wish they had more of-whether time, comfort, or convenience?

For instance, a coworker who often complains about long workdays might appreciate a wellness-oriented gift like a personalized candle, a high-quality thermal mug, or a desk plant that brightens their environment. Someone who enjoys creative pursuits could be delighted by customized art supplies, a monogrammed sketchbook, or a subscription to a hobby-related service. By aligning the gift with your colleague’s genuine interests, you demonstrate that you see them as an individual, not just as a co-worker.

It’s also essential to consider practical aspects such as their lifestyle, office policies, and potential sensitivities. Does your office have strict rules about food, fragrances, or alcohol? Is the recipient health-conscious or environmentally aware? Tailoring your choice with these factors in mind ensures your gift is thoughtful, considerate, and well-received.

Avoid These Pitfalls When Choosing Gifts

Even the best intentions can be undermined by common pitfalls. First, avoid gifts that are overly personal or potentially controversial, such as perfumes, clothing, or items tied to religious or political beliefs. These may be interpreted as intrusive or inappropriate in a professional setting.

Another common mistake is relying too heavily on humor that could be misinterpreted. While funny gifts can be enjoyable, they carry the risk of offending or embarrassing the recipient if the joke doesn’t land as intended. Likewise, generic or impersonal items-like a standard gift card without thought or context-can make the recipient feel overlooked rather than appreciated.

Overcomplicating the gift is another trap. A gift that is too extravagant, expensive, or elaborate can create discomfort, implying obligations or expectations that may be unintended. The ideal personalized gift strikes a balance: thoughtful, relevant, and sincere, but not overwhelming.

Finally, timing and presentation matter. Even the perfect gift can lose impact if it arrives late or is presented without care. Taking the time to wrap or present your gift with elegance adds a layer of respect and consideration, enhancing the overall impression.

How To Locate The Perfect Present

Finding the perfect gift often requires a combination of research, creativity, and resourcefulness. Start with observation and note-taking throughout the weeks leading up to the holidays. Pay attention to conversations, social media posts (if appropriate), and subtle hints the recipient may drop about things they enjoy.

Next, explore options both online and in local stores. E-commerce platforms allow for easy customization, engraving, or monogramming, and offer access to unique gifts that may not be found locally. Local boutiques, craft fairs, and artisan markets can provide one-of-a-kind items with a personal touch.

Collaboration can also be effective. Discussing ideas with mutual coworkers can help you uncover preferences or subtle interests you might have missed. Group gifts can allow for more ambitious or luxurious personalized items, while still distributing costs.

Finally, think creatively. Sometimes the most cherished gifts are experiences rather than objects-personalized virtual classes, curated subscription boxes, or tickets to a local event that aligns with their interests. By expanding your definition of ’gift’ beyond material items, you can find something truly memorable and meaningful.
